Carl Maria von Weber [1786-1826] was one of the leading German composers of the early 19thC, one of the first Romantics and a major influence on Chopin, Mendelssohn and Liszt. He is now best known for his operas, and especially their overtures, and for some clarinet pieces, but he also wrote for piano.

| Variations on an original Air, in F, Op. 9 | MIDI | piano | |
|
This piece was sequenced in 2023 from a copy in a collection
helpfully entitled Music.
There is a theme and seven variations, with a coda.
The theme is marked Andante con espressione, but
the variations differ widely in style and tempo. The book, which consists of six sections bound together, has absolutely no publisher or copyright information, but clearly dates from the late 19thC. I've omitted all the repeats, which double the length of the piece and add nothing musically. The pedalling follows the score, and is rather light. | |||
